It is accepted in the scientific community that the principles of natural and selective breeding show themselves in the resulting animal’s behavior as well as its physical characteristics. Studies tell us that genetics determine aproximately 60% of behavior and the environment (“how,” “when” and “what” in the raising of the dog) determine approximately 40%, as long as those environments are within a normal range of experiences.
